McMorris Rodgers to Host Eastern Washington Transportation Tour and Summit

(Spokane, WA) With Congress set to consider a major transportation funding bill next year, Congresswoman Cathy McMorris wants to make sure Eastern Washington is well-positioned to have that funding bill reflect Eastern Washington’s regional priorities like the north-south corridor and U.S. 12 improvements.

That is why today McMorris Rodgers is hosting a transportation roundtable at WSU Spokane. Eastern Washington business, government and transportation leaders will join McMorris Rodgers and Representative John Mica at WSU Spokane to discuss the future of transportation and infrastructure improvements in Eastern Washington. Representative Mica (R-FL) is the Ranking Republican on the Transportation and Infrastructure Committee–the committee in the House that will determine where federal transportation dollars are spent.

“I am pleased Representative Mica will be able to see first-hand the many important transportation projects underway in Eastern Washington,” McMorris Rodgers said. “Without a doubt, developing Eastern Washington’s transportation infrastructure is important in order to provide better conditions to improve the flow of traffic, make our roads safer, and transport products grown and made in our region.”
